Blockchain in Sports & Entertainment
Explores blockchain disruption in sports and entertainment, covering tokenized franchise ownership, ticket scalping elimination, and athlete wealth building. Highlights that 78% of NFL players go broke within 3 years of retirement — and how blockchain can change that.
